Latest Patents

Ju Hyeon Lee holds a patent for "Indolinone derivatives as inhibitors of maternal embryonic leucine zipper kinase." This patent focuses on indolinone compounds, compositions, and methods for inhibiting maternal embryonic leucine zipper kinase (MELK). The research also explores the potential of these compounds in the treatment or prevention of cancers, including triple-negative breast cancer. She has 1 patent to her name.
